首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于计算html页面大小的javascript/jquery脚本

用于计算HTML页面大小的JavaScript/jQuery脚本可以通过以下方式实现:

  1. 使用JavaScript计算页面大小:
  2. 使用JavaScript计算页面大小:
  3. 使用jQuery计算页面大小:
  4. 使用jQuery计算页面大小:

这段脚本可以用于计算HTML页面的大小,无论是响应式设计还是需要根据页面大小进行其他操作,都可以使用这个脚本来获取页面的宽度和高度。

优势:

  • 简单易用:只需几行代码即可获取页面大小。
  • 跨浏览器兼容:可以在大多数现代浏览器中正常工作。
  • 动态适应:可以根据页面大小进行相应的布局和操作。

应用场景:

  • 响应式设计:根据页面大小调整布局和样式。
  • 动态加载:根据页面大小加载不同的内容或资源。
  • 数据可视化:根据页面大小展示不同的图表或数据展示方式。

推荐的腾讯云相关产品和产品介绍链接地址:

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jqueryjavascript 获取元素尺寸大小对比

jquery获取尺寸方法 width() 方法设置或返回元素宽度(不包括内边距、边框或外边距)。 height() 方法设置或返回元素高度(不包括内边距、边框或外边距)。...innerWidth() 方法返回元素宽度(包括内边距)。 innerHeight() 方法返回元素高度(包括内边距)。 outerWidth() 方法返回元素宽度(包括内边距和边框)。...outerHeight() 方法返回元素高度(包括内边距和边框)。 js获取尺寸方法 clientWidth 是对象可见宽度,不包滚动条等边线,会随窗口显示大小改变。...offsetWidth 是对象可见宽度,包滚动条等边线,会随窗口显示大小改变。 Window 尺寸 有三种方法能够确定浏览器窗口尺寸(浏览器视口,不包括工具栏和滚动条)。...,如电脑大小是1920*1080,屏幕高度就是1080) clientWidth = width + padding offsetWidth = width + padding + border 1.

1.8K30

JavaScript 在vue页面下实现鼠标拖拽div改变其大小,适用于鹰眼地图,街景地图等。

首先看效果,如图,鼠标悬浮在地图右上角小框中时,提示“拖动调整大小”,可以给小框加个好看图标。点击可以进行拖拽。 ?... <div title="拖动调整<em>大小</em>...其中:e.target.parentNode.parentNode;.children[0]是通过鼠标点击<em>的</em>对象来获取要设置<em>的</em>对象<em>的</em>宽高。...直接用document.getElementById 比较方便,即便元素<em>的</em>嵌入关系改变了,一样可以找到该对象。...注:拖拽箭头是利用鼠标拖动<em>的</em>地方是div<em>的</em>右上方,所以箭头是右上方向<em>的</em>箭头,即设置div<em>的</em>css中<em>的</em>属性为cursor: ne-resize; 参考http://www.w3school.com.cn/

4.3K40
  • 浅谈JavaScript如何操作html DOMJavaScript 能够改变页面所有 HTML 元素改变 HTML 样式** JavaScript 有能力对 HTML 事件做出反应**添加和删除

    ** 通过 HTML DOM,可访问 JavaScript HTML 文档所有元素。** HTML DOM 树 ? Paste_Image.png DOM树很重要,特别是其中各节点之间关系。...本文将会讲到以下内容: 通过可编程对象模型,JavaScript 获得了足够能力来创建动态 HTML。...JavaScript 能够改变页面所有 HTML 元素 JavaScript 能够改变页面所有 HTML 属性 JavaScript 能够改变页面所有 CSS 样式 JavaScript 能够对页面所有事件做出反应...JavaScript 能够改变页面所有 HTML 元素 首先,我们要知道如何查找HTML元素,通常有三种方法: id tag classs 就是分别通过id,tag,class名字查找HTML...> JavaScript 改变 HTML 元素内容。

    5.8K10

    使用 HTML、CSS 和 JavaScript 实时计算

    在本文中,我们将讨论如何使用HTML,CSS和JavaScript开发实时计算器。通常,如果我们观察任何实时计算器,我们知道它有 - 数字网格(0-9 和 00)。...使用CSS 我们使用CSS来管理HTML内容,如内容颜色,宽度,高度,字体大小,填充,边距等。 JavaScript 使用 在计算器中,确定有不同按钮,所有这些按钮都有不同功能。...开发实时计算器 以下是分别以 HTML、CSS 和 JavaScript 格式文件来开发实时计算器 - 计算器.html 这是我们下面计算 HTML 文件。...在这里,我们使用 HTML 脚本来创建计算器 UI 内容。我们包括计算按钮、输入字段等。...> 以下是我们计算 CSS 文件;我们使用CSS来管理HTML内容,例如放置内容颜色,宽度,高度,字体大小,填充,边距等。

    2.8K20

    前端学习历程

    ,原则上HTML代码只能体现网页结构      建议写法 $(“#foo”).click(function(){});   优点:jQuery是追加绑定,绑多少执行多少,还解决了IE不兼容问题。...,不仅在网页绘制或大小改变时计算,即使我们滚动屏幕或者移动鼠标的时候也在计算,因此我们还是尽量避免使用它来防止使用不当而造成性能损耗。...HTML5中新加了async关键字,可以让脚本异步执行。...同时将Javascript和CSS从inline变为external也减小了网页内容大小。...使用外部Javascript和CSS文件决定因素在于这些外部文件重用率,如果用户在浏览我们页面时会访问多次相同页面或者可以重用脚本不同页面,那么外部文件形式可以为你带来很大好处。

    1.4K60

    JavaScript学习笔记(五)——Ajax

    jQuery与Ajax综合应用 Ajax是 Asynchronous JavaScript And XML 缩写,意思是异步JavaScript和xml,他是基于JavaScript和HTTP请求一种网页编程模式...以一种异步方式与web服务器通信,并且只更新页面的一部分。...() jQuery插件用于开发 jQuery插件就是开发爱好者自己利用jQuery制作特效,然后打包成js文件,发布到网上供大家使用脚本集合。...好用jQuery插件: 1. jQuery Form插件 jQuery Form是一个优秀表单插件,它可以非常容易地使HTML表单支持Ajax。...jQuery Form插件有两个核心方法: ajaxForm() 适用于以提交表单方式处理数据,需要在表单中标明表单action、id、method属性,最好在表单中提供submit按钮。

    1.9K10

    2018年Web开发人员应该学习12个框架

    由于它是一个JavaScript库,你可以使用标记在HTML页面上包含它。它使用Directives扩展HTML属性,并使用Expressions将数据绑定到HTML。...传统上,JavaScript被用作客户端脚本语言,它与HTML一起用于在客户端提供动态行为。它在Web浏览器上运行,但Node.js允许你在服务器端运行JavaScript。...Bootstrap最初由Twitter提供给我们,提供基于HTML和CSS设计模板,用于排版,表单,按钮,导航和其他界面组件,以及可选JavaScript扩展。...jQuery一直是我最喜欢,我建议每个开发人员学习jQuery。它使客户端脚本非常容易。 你可以通过编写几行代码来执行动画,发送HTTP请求,重新加载页面以及执行客户端验证。...你可以将Spark用于内存计算,以便将ETL,机器学习和数据科学工作负载用于Hadoop。 10)Cordova Apache Cordova是最初由Nitobi创建另一个移动应用程序开发框架。

    5.5K40

    计算机毕业设计——基于html汽车商城网站页面设计与实现论文源码ppt(35页) HTML+CSS+JavaScript

    原始HTML+CSS+JS页面设计, web大学生网页设计作业源码,画面精明,排版整洁,内容丰富,主题鲜明,非常适合初学者学习使用。...3.知识应用:技术方面主要应用了网页知识中: Div+CSS、鼠标滑过特效、Table、导航栏效果、Banner、表单、二级三级页面等,视频、 音频元素 、Flash,同时设计了Logo(源文件)所需知识点...">购物中心 我首页...(具体可根据个人要求而定) 页面分为页头、菜单导航栏(最好可下拉)、中间内容板块、页脚四大部分;undefined 所有页面相互超链接,可到三级页面,有5-10个页面组成; 页面样式风格统一布局显示正常...,不错乱,使用Div+Css技术; 菜单美观、醒目,二级菜单可正常弹出与跳转; 要有JS特效,如定时切换和手动切换图片新闻; 页面中有多媒体元素,如gif、视频、音乐,表单技术使用; 页面清爽、美观、

    55810

    程序员Web面试之jQuery

    jqueryJavaScript关系,jQuery会取代JavaScript吗? JavaScript:是一门Web最流行脚本语言。 jQuery: 是一个优秀Javascript框架。...在开发Web页面,考虑最多问题之一是页面在客户端电脑响应:时间越短,用户体验越好。 而制约用户体验关键因素之一是浏览器下载Web文件大小,包括*.html、图片、*.js、*.css等文件。...不同: jQuery.js文件,适合让程序员阅读,如下图所示: jQuery.min.js文件,通过压缩和删除所有的空格,以节省带宽和空间,使得文件更小,用于网络传输,不适合程序员阅读。...一次完整HTML DOM加载完成,会触发HTML“document.ready”事件,而要通过JQuery访问HTML元素,则需要页面HTML元素加载完成。...如SpreadJS,这是一款企业级JavaScript电子表格控件,能将电子表格、数据可视化及计算功能集成在JavaScriptWeb应用程序中。

    2.6K100

    【面试】1093- 21 道关于性能优化面试题(附答案)

    随着前端项目不断扩大,浏览器渲染压力变得越来越重。配置好一点计算机可以顺利地展现页面;配置低一些计算机渲染页面的性能就不那么可观了。 性能优化部分面试题主要考察应试者对网站性能优化了解。...,它需要一边下载图片一边计算大小。...脚本处理不当会阻塞页面加载、渲染,因此在使用时需注意。 (1)把CSS写在页面头部,把 JavaScript程序写在页面尾部或异步操作中。...重设图片大小是指在页面、CSS、 JavaScript文件等中多次重置图片大小,多次重设图片大小会引发图片多次重绘,影响性能 (4)图片尽量避免使用 DataURL。...HTML5中data属性有助于插入数据,特别是前、后端数据交换;jQuery data( )方法能够有效地利用HTML5属性来自动获取数据。 21、哪些方法能提升移动端CSS3动画体验?

    1.6K20

    awesome-javascript-cn

    官网 SeaJS:用于 Web 模块加载器。官网 HeadJS:HEAD 唯一脚本。...官网 paper.js:是矢量图形脚本瑞士军刀 —— 使用 HTML5 Canvas 将 Scriptographer  移植到 JavaScript 官网和浏览器。...官网 jquery.rest:一个让 RESTful API 更易使用 jQuery 插件。官网 视觉检测 tracking.js:在 web 上实现计算视觉一种现代方法。...官网 colorbox:轻量、可自定义灯箱 jQuery 插件。官网 fancyBox:提供了良好优雅方式,为页面图片、html 内容和多媒体添加缩放功能工具。...官网 stretchy:自适应大小 form 元素,表单本应该是这样。官网 list.js:向表格、列表等 HTML 元素添加搜索、排序、过滤和自适应功能库。在已有 HTML 上增加可视化。

    10.7K80

    21道关于性能优化面试题(附答案)

    随着前端项目不断扩大,浏览器渲染压力变得越来越重。配置好一点计算机可以顺利地展现页面;配置低一些计算机渲染页面的性能就不那么可观了。 性能优化部分面试题主要考察应试者对网站性能优化了解。...,它需要一边下载图片一边计算大小。...脚本处理不当会阻塞页面加载、渲染,因此在使用时需注意。 (1)把CSS写在页面头部,把 JavaScript程序写在页面尾部或异步操作中。...重设图片大小是指在页面、CSS、 JavaScript文件等中多次重置图片大小,多次重设图片大小会引发图片多次重绘,影响性能 (4)图片尽量避免使用 DataURL。...HTML5中data属性有助于插入数据,特别是前、后端数据交换;jQuery data( )方法能够有效地利用HTML5属性来自动获取数据。 21、哪些方法能提升移动端CSS3动画体验?

    1.8K20

    前端知识体系整理(不断更新)

    postMessage跨域通讯 jQuery 可阅读yuanyan同学jQuery编程实践 安全问题 XSS CSRF SQL注入 敏感信息采用安全传输(SSL/HTTPS) 上传限制(大小、mime...html结构:SEO友好,利于维护 精简html结构:嵌套过复杂结构会导致浏览器构建DOM树缓慢 html最小化:html大小直接关系到下载速度,移除内联css,javascript,甚至模板片,...有条件的话尽可能压缩html,去除注释、空行等无用文本 总是设置文档字符集:如果不设置,浏览器在渲染页面前会做一些查找,先搜索可进行解析字符 显式设置图片宽高:减少页面重绘(参考【高性能前端1】高性能...避免@import引入样式表:IE低版本浏览器会再页面构建好之后再去加载import样式表,会导致白屏 样式表放head里,脚本延后引入 未完待续。。。...CSS优化 避免css表达式:css表达式会不断重复计算,导致页面性能下降 避免AlphaImageLoader滤镜:这个滤镜问题在于浏览器加载图片时它会终止内容呈现并且冻结浏览器(引自【高性能前端

    1.6K20

    浏览器中JavaScript:文档对象模型与 DOM 操作

    作为运行在浏览器中脚本语言,它对于网页操作非常有用。在本文中,我们将看到可以用哪些手段来修改 HTML 文档和交互。 什么是文档对象模型? 文档对象模型是在浏览器中一切基础。但它究竟是什么呢?...当我们访问网页时,浏览器会计算出如何解释每个 HTML 元素。这样它就可以创建 HTML 文档虚拟表示,并保存在内存中。...HTML 页面被转换为树状结构并且每个 HTML 元素都变成一个叶子结点,连接到父分支。看一下这个简单 HTML 页面: 1<!...文档界面有许多实用功能,比如 querySelector(),一种用于选择给定页面内任何 HTML 元素方法: 1document.querySelector('h1'); window 表示当前窗口浏览器...这样做有很多理由,其他库会增加 JavaScript 程序加载时间和大小,更不用说 DOM 操作在技术面试中出现越来越多。

    61710
    领券